C66 fullerene encaging a scandium dimer
Chunru Wang,Tsutomu Kai,Tetsuo Tomiyama,Takuya Yoshida,Yuji Kobayashi,Eiji Nishibori,Masaki Takata,Makoto Sakata,Hisanori Shinohara +8 more
TL;DR: The production and characterization of an IPR-violating metallofullerene, Sc2@C66, a C66 fullerene encaging a scandium dimer is described and results indicate that encapsulation of the metal dimer significantly stabilizes this otherwise extremely unstable C66 Fullerene.
